Caption

Closing of a Public Alley in Square 2068, S.O. 25-01801, Act of 2025

Impact

The bill follows established legislative procedures as outlined in the District of Columbia Home Rule Act and aligns with the Street and Alley Closing and Acquisition Procedures Act. By closing the alley, it is expected to enhance the efficiency of the site plan for the proposed residential project while ensuring that access to services will not be hindered for neighboring properties, thanks to alternate access points provided by adjacent alleys along Ordway and Porter streets. This could set a precedent for handling similar cases of property development and urban planning in the future.

Summary

B26-0166, titled the 'Closing of a Public Alley in Square 2068, S.O. 25-01801, Act of 2025,' proposes to close a specific portion of the public alley system in Square 2068, specifically the 15-foot-wide L-shaped alley section adjacent to Lots 92, 811, and 818. The closure is initiated to facilitate the consolidation of properties in the area, which is necessary for the construction of a new residential building by 3500 CT LLC and Uptown Heights LLC. This development plans to include approximately 13,180 square feet of residential space along with parking for 12 to 14 vehicles.
